Output 266061ca8ab73bb165f3724046872f630c911c8b1d5266be2b5051e9a13cabf4:2

value
97488
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f09b959f8229b40f2df327e173ace33e80f0a7 OP_EQUALVERIFY OP_CHECKSIG
address
14eBbCfNz7BrMKJ8omGnaZVidw5axyH2q2
transaction
266061ca8ab73bb165f3724046872f630c911c8b1d5266be2b5051e9a13cabf4
spent
true